Kinds Of Car Keys
Modern automobiles come with different types of keys, each requiring specific methods for replacement. The main categories include:

Key Type | Description |
---|---|
Conventional Keys | These are standard metal keys that do not require any electronic parts. They are relatively simple and affordable to replace. |
Transponder Keys | These keys include a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system for included security. Replacement typically requires configuring the brand-new key to the vehicle. |
Key Fobs | These remote keys often consist of features such as keyless entry and ignition. Replacement can be more complicated and expensive due to the need for reprogramming. |
Smart Keys | A sophisticated variation of key fobs, smart keys allow drivers to begin their vehicles without physically inserting the key. Replacement can be the most costly and complex process among all key types. |

Expense of Emergency Car Key Replacement
The expenses connected with emergency car key replacement can vary commonly depending on several elements, including the type of key, the make and design of the vehicle, and the service provider.
Here's a breakdown of estimated costs:
Key Type | Estimated Cost Range |
---|---|
Traditional Keys | ₤ 2 to ₤ 10 |
Transponder Keys | ₤ 50 to ₤ 200 |
Key Fobs | ₤ 100 to ₤ 400 |
Smart Keys | ₤ 200 to ₤ 600 and upwards |
Note: Prices can vary based upon place and company.
